The type_info class describes type information generated by an implementation. Constructor & Destructor Documentation virtual std::type_info::~type_info () [virtual] Destructor first. Being the first non-inline virtual function, this controls in which translation unit the vtable is emitted. The compiler makes use of that information to know where to emit the runtime- mandated type_info structures in the new-abi. Member Function Documentation bool std::type_info::before (const type_info & __arg) const [noexcept] Returns true if *this precedes __arg in the implementation's collation order. const char * std::type_info::name () const [inline], [noexcept] Returns an implementation-defined byte string; this is not portable between compilers!
